Hoyt Park – A Pet-Friendly Landmark in Saginaw, Michigan

Located in the heart of Saginaw, Michigan, Hoyt Park is a welcoming destination for local families and their pets. Featuring wheelchair accessible entrances and parking, this historic park is renowned for its lively atmosphere, clean grounds, and strong sense of community. Frequent events like baseball games, softball tournaments, and festive gatherings make it a bustling hub, while its proximity to the Saginaw Zoo adds to its family appeal.

Although Hoyt Park is not a dedicated dog park, dogs are welcome, making it a popular spot for pet owners seeking green space and pet-friendly trails. The park also boasts amenities such as public restrooms, a playground for children, and open grassy areas perfect for relaxing with your furry friend. Whether you’re visiting for a local event, a daily walk, or simply to soak in the vibrant Saginaw community, Hoyt Park stands out as a beloved, multi-purpose recreational spot.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• Are dogs allowed at Hoyt Park? Yes, dogs are allowed at Hoyt Park.
  • Is the park wheelchair accessible? Yes, Hoyt Park has both a wheelchair accessible entrance and parking lot.
  • Are restrooms available for owners? Yes, public restrooms are available at the park.
  • Is there a playground or activities for kids nearby? Yes, the park has a playground and regularly hosts family-friendly activities.
  • Is the park regularly cleaned and maintained? Yes, reviews mention that the park is clean and well-maintained, thanks to dedicated volunteers.
  • Where is the best place to park? Parking is available along the road, but some areas may be less convenient during busy events.
